Wall cladding sheets should be specified by profile, thickness, coating/colour, length, orientation and support spacing. Corner, base, head and opening flashings should be coordinated with the same profile and finish. Country RFQ Comparison
Use the project specification first, then align quantity, documents, packing and delivery scope before comparing commercial offers.
| Parameter | Why it matters | RFQ basis |
|---|---|---|
| Material | Defines the material or grade basis that the quotation must match. | GI / PPGI / coated steel |
| Supply | Defines the product form, profile or supply configuration required for the job. | Corrugated wall sheets by profile and finish |
| Common use | Connects the product specification with the real fabrication, installation or project duty. | Wall cladding, partitions and exterior covering |
| RFQ details | Prevents incomplete or non-comparable quotations by stating the purchase-ready inputs. | Profile, thickness, coating, colour, length and quantity |
| Quantity & release plan | Affects sourcing, packing, commercial terms and delivery planning. | State total quantity and any phased or partial-delivery requirement. |
| Documentation | Project acceptance may depend on the correct material documents. | State certificate, traceability or project-document requirements before quotation. |
| Delivery | Destination and receiving conditions affect packing and logistics. | State country, city/site, receiving constraints and required delivery window. |
